Hello guys, i am having trouble with my first grow and i am looking for help. I have two plants, the older one developed a deficiency with brown spots on the leaves and is in horrible shape. Her leaves are drooping and many have dried out and died, being 72 days old and flowering since 15 of March, she has no smell and no trichomes at all.
Honestly i don't expect that she will produce anything, but i do not want to throw her away yet.

The younger one though was perfectly healthy with thick stems, huge dark green leaves etc. She started flowering about two weeks ago and is starting to develop the exact same deficiency as the older one. I don't want to lose her too but i cannot figure out what is the problem. Yesterday i fed it and upped the dose to 8+8 ml of biobizz grow and bloom in 4lt of water, Ph 5.5 and 6.2 in order to get a better range.
The medium is biocanna biottera plus, peat/coco, i am using Ro water.
